The Basics of Spinal Manipulation

Spinal manipulation is a technique in which your chiropractor uses their hands or a device to apply force, called a controlled thrust, to the joints in your spine. This thrusting motion moves the joint more than it would naturally, thus moving it back into place or realigning your spine. Your chiropractor will combine this treatment with others, such as massage therapy, exercise, and physical therapy, in order to reduce inflammation, improve posture and nerve function, and provide pain relief. 

What Conditions are Treated with Spinal Manipulation? 

Spinal manipulation is one of the most common chiropractic care treatments sought in the US. It can be used for general wellness and prevention, as well as because its benefits include improved immune function, and higher energy, memory, and concentration levels. Most commonly, spinal manipulation is used to treat chronic pain associated with accidents, injury, or overuse disorders caused by poor posture or workplace habits.

A chiropractor near you may also recommend spinal manipulation as part of your chiropractic care treatment if you suffer from lower back pain, sciatica, neck pain, or headaches.
